Beirut-based rapper and producer, BeatLaLipos, delves deep into the common worries and uncertainty surrounding the Coronavirus pandemic with his new release, ‘Kememet’ (masks). Featuring Lebanese singer, Christy Samaha, the track’s lyrics, at various points, seem almost scattered, perhaps intentionally to mirror the scattered sequence of thoughts during moments of panic or confusion

The up-tempo, reggaeton-inspired beat is softened by Samaha’s delicate harmonies in the chorus, which – in some ways – makes the track much more complete. BeatLaLipos delves into a status of introspection where he wonders why this global crisis is happening, and whether humanity is paying the price for previous mistakes. The rapper also comments on people being forced to separate and becoming more and more paranoid in these unpredictable circumstances. 

BeatLaLipos – also the producer of the track and part of the Jnood Beirut crew – has built a respectable battle rap reputation thanks to his participation in The Arena ME, the region’s first official rap league based in Beirut, where he has  has gone head-to-head with heavyweights such as Amman-based rapper, The Synaptik, in the past.
